Tung Chung Line is one of the ten lines of the Hong Kong mass transit railway system. It is also one of the two MTR lines serving the Hong Kong International Airport at Chek Lap Kok, the other being the Airport Express. Together, they were originally known as the Lantau airport Railway.

The Tung Chung Line covers a distance of 30.5 km, crossing the Kap Shui Mun Bridge and the Tsing Ma Bridge. It serves 8 stations. The line opened on 21 June, 1998.

Stations on the Tung Chung Line

Station Name Interchange
Tung Cheng MTR Station
Sunny Bay MTR Station Disneyland Resort Line
Tsing Yi MTR Station Airport Express
Lai King MTR Station Tsuen Wan Line
Nam Cheong MTR Station West Rail Line
Olympic MTR Station
Kowloon MTR Station Airport Express
Hong Kong MTR Station Airport Express, Tsuen Wan Line, Island Line
